The Naval Acquisition Development Program (NADP) is a premier developmental and leadership program designed to enhance the professional knowledge and capabilities of personnel recruited into the Acquisition Workforce (AWF) for the Department of the Navy (DON). The Naval Acquisition Career Center (NACC) manages the NADP in a joint effort with naval commands to prepare the future workforce. The NADP offers an extraordinary opportunity for those who desire to rapidly advance their professional career and feel a sense of pride in supporting the mission of the DON. The program supports our talented NADP employees by providing a challenging environment with opportunities to become certified in a designated functional area, travel for enriching learning experiences, exposure to senior leadership, and upon eligibility, pursue a graduate degree if desired. Many successful participants have gone onto high-ranking positions within DON – a further testament to the power of our program in developing future acquisition leaders.
